>> I know that both options are not really optimal, but I don't think
>> that we really want to upgrade the inner core of the entire thing to
>> the next major version in a minor of Karaf. There where some API
>> changes from a user lvl of view which disallow to drop the same bundle
>> into a 4.2/4.3 environment and a 5.0. I do not really fancy the idea
>> of breaking compatibility between minor releases. If ppls setup break
>> from one minor to the next they lost trust and upgrade ways too late
>> although there should be no reason.
